Does this replace anybody's job?
Not in the businesses we work with, and we would say so if it did. What it removes is the repetitive part of a job — the retrieval, the retyping, the checking of things that are usually fine — which is the part people are worst at when they are busy and least sorry to lose. How do we know it is working?
Somebody stops doing something. If the manual process is still running alongside the automation after a month, it has not been trusted and the work has been added rather than removed. That is worth checking for deliberately rather than assuming the rollout went well. The same goes for Drammen.
What data do you need?
Whatever the process currently relies on, which is frequently less complete than anybody expects. The first output of this work is often a list of things nobody was recording, and for some Drammen businesses the honest answer is to start recording before automating.
